New coach in Kirkland Lake
Trevor Ritchie has been hired as the new head coach of the Kirkland Lake Gold Miners of the Northern Ontario Jr. Hockey League, according to a source with knowledge of the situation.
Ritchie spent the latter portion of the 2018-2019 season as coach and general manager of the Elliot Lake Wildcats after Corey Bricknell departed the NOJHL team for a pro job in Hungary.
With Ritchie at the helm, Elliot Lake finished a distant fifth in the six-team West Division of the NOJHL and then lost in the preliminary round of the playoffs.
Kirkland Lake has been searching for a new hockey boss since parting ways with Ryan Wood after a 2018-2019 season in which the Gold Miners finished in second place in the East Division before losing in the semi-finals of the playoffs.
